hrmmm, well thats not good. There is nothing in the apparmor package
that requires libc6 but because of how library deps get generated ...

You could try force installing it (I've never tried this) and it might
work. Or you could build the package or just the parser from scratch.

  apt-get source apparmor
  apt-get build-dep apparmor
  cd apparmor-XXXX/parser                                #where XXX is the 
version info etc
  make

this will create a new apparmor_parser in the apparmor-XXXX/parser directory 
that you can then copy to /sbin/
If you would prefer to make a package, that is possible too but is a couple 
more steps
